Ingredients:

  • 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 3/4 cup packed brown sugar
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 2 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• Optional: 1 cup chopped walnuts or pecans (for extra crunch)

Steps to Make Chocolate Chip Cookies:

Preheat the Oven

 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line two baking sheets with parchment paper to prevent the cookies from sticking.

Cream the Butter and Sugars 

In a large mixing bowl, beat together the softened but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ar using a hand mixer or stand mixer. Mix on medium speed until the mixture is light and fluffy, about 3 minutes. This step helps to create a soft, chewy texture in your cookies.

Add Eggs and Vanilla 

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ract. Make sure everything is well combined.

Combine Dry Ingredients

 In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ing on low speed until just combined. Be careful not to over-mix, as this can result in tough cookies.

Stir in the Chocolate Chips (and Nuts)

 Fold in the chocolate chips and optional nuts (if using). The dough will be thick and slightly sticky, which is perfect for creating soft, gooey cookies.

Scoop the Dough

 Using a cookie scoop or tablespoon, scoop out dough balls about 1 1/2 inches in diameter and place them on the prepared baking sheets, spacing them about 2 inches apart. If you like your cookies to be extra large, you can make them bigger, but just remember to adjust the baking time accordingly.

Bake the Cookies

 Bake the cookies in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own but the centers are still slightly soft. If you prefer crispier cookies, leave them in a minute or two longer, but be careful not to overbake.

Cool and Enjoy 

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heets for 2 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. This helps them firm up without losing their soft texture. Enjoy them with a glass of milk, or just eat them as they are—they’re perfect either way!

Tips for Perfect Chocolate Chip Cookies:

  1. Use room temperature butter

Softened butter will mix more evenly into the dough, giving you a smoother texture and better results.

  1. Don’t overmix the dough:

 Overmixing can cause the cookies to be tough. Mix until just combined!

  1. Chill the dough:

 If you have time, chilling the dough for at least 30 minutes can help the cookies spread less and enhance the flavor.

  1. Add sea salt:

 A sprinkle of sea salt on top before baking can bring out the richness of the chocolate chips.

  1. Check the cookies early:

 Every oven is different, so start checking the cookies a minute or two before the recommended time to avoid over-baking.

FAQS

How do I prevent my cookies from being too flat?

Flat cookies are often a result of too much butter, overmixing the dough, or not chilling the dough. Ensure you chill the dough for at least 30 minutes, and don’t overmix the wet and dry ingredients.

How should I store the cookies?

Store your baked c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to one week. To keep them soft, you can place a slice of bread in the container with the cookies to help retain moisture.

Why did my cookies spread too much?

Cookies may spread too much if:
The dough was too warm when placed on the baking sheet.
You didn’t chill the dough before baking. To prevent this, make sure to chill the dough for at least 30 minutes before baking.

. How can I make my chocolate chip cookies chewier?

Use more brown sugar than granulated sugar.
Avoid overmixing the dough.
Chill the dough for at least 30 minutes before baking.

What should I do if my cookies are too hard?

If your cookies are too hard, it’s likely due to overbaking. For softer cookies, remove them from the oven as soon as the edges turn golden but the centers are still soft. You can also add a small piece of bread to your container to help soften them.
